A slot is the position on the football field occupied by a wide receiver who lines up pre-snap between and slightly behind the outside wide receivers and offensive linemen. Historically, slot receivers have been shorter and quicker than traditional wide receivers, making them more vulnerable to big hits from defenses. However, recent seasons have seen more teams rely on slot receivers, as offenses shift to more three-wide receiver/back alignments.

When playing a slot machine, players insert cash or, in “ticket-in, ticket-out” machines, a paper ticket with a barcode. Then they activate a lever or button (either physical or on a touchscreen) to spin the reels and rearrange the symbols. A winning combination earns credits based on the pay table. Depending on the machine, symbols may include classic fruits, bells, and stylized lucky sevens.

Modern electronic slot machines have microprocessors that assign different probabilities to each symbol on each reel. This is why some symbols appear more often than others.
